DARK QUEST LIGHTS THE WAY WITH MORE GREAT FICTION

 

HOWELL, NJ – Dark Quest Books and award-winning author L. Jagi Lamplighter have entered into a four-book deal for a new young-adult fantasy series entitled The Unexpected Enlightenment of Rachel Griffin. Book one in the series is to release at the end of 2013. The series will serve as the flagship releases for Dark Quest’s new Young Adult Imprint, Palomino Press, to be overseen by Acquisitions Editor Christine Norris.

 

The series follows the misadventures of young Rachel Griffin, student at the Roanoke Academy for the Sorcerous Arts. An eidetic memory has the unexpected effect of allowing Rachel to see past enchantments sorcerers use to hide their secrets. Rachel discovers layers to reality she never before knew existed, changing her view of the world forever. These unique attributes and her own innate curiosity lead Rachel down the path of danger and adventure.

 

Ms. Lamplighter is the author of the acclaimed Prospero’s Daughter trilogy (Prospero Lost, Prospero in Hell, and Prospero Regained) available from TOR Books (www.tor.com), as well as co-editor of the award-winning Bad-Ass Faeries anthologies, available from Mundania Press (www.mundania.com).
